Transaction 058530579d1ded83ef6bfba24dbd205ff6a87732fd17b7b0a5763c943565eb6d

1 Input
2 Outputs
  • 058530579d1ded83ef6bfba24dbd205ff6a87732fd17b7b0a5763c943565eb6d:0
  • value  3112619086
    address  mpTYhr8RyYR2t3YK1S8EpFdpcScwyqxwSN
  • 058530579d1ded83ef6bfba24dbd205ff6a87732fd17b7b0a5763c943565eb6d:1
  • value  110000000
    address  2MwQAzjjhjUCdTm6Z5yGzkWsqpAV3VZ1BNj